powered by simpleCommunicator - 2.0.51     © 2025 Programmizd 02
Форумы / Oracle [игнор отключен] [закрыт для гостей] / Помогите с функциями и курсорами
2 сообщений из 2, страница 1 из 1
Помогите с функциями и курсорами
    #32074452
slap
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Вообщем такая задачка - у меня функция возвращает курсор, как мне перенаправить этот курсор на другую переменную, а то я же не могу работать с этим курсором по имени функции

Подскажите ПЖЛСТ как
...
Рейтинг: 0 / 0
Помогите с функциями и курсорами
    #32075189
avle
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Можно вот так, например, попробовать.
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
declare 
  type RefCursor is ref cursor;

  RC RefCursor;
  s varchar2( 10 );
  
  function getRC return RefCursor is
    res RefCursor; 
  begin
    open Res for select * from dual;
    return res;
  end;
begin
    RC := getRC;
    loop 
      fetch RC into s;
      exit when RC%notfound;
      
      dbms_output.put_line(s);
    end loop; 
end;
...
Рейтинг: 0 / 0
2 сообщений из 2, страница 1 из 1
Форумы / Oracle [игнор отключен] [закрыт для гостей] / Помогите с функциями и курсорами
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]